Green Bean and Ground Beef Stir Fry

This stir fry features ground beef marinated in a flavorful mixture of soy sauce, garlic, ginger, brown sugar, and chili sauce, combined with tender, blistered green beans. The dish balances savory, sweet, and spicy notes, with fresh aromatics like ginger and garlic enhancing the flavor. Cooking the green beans separately before adding the beef preserves their texture and color. The finished dish is a hearty, well-seasoned meal component suitable for quick dinners.

Description

Green Bean and Ground Beef Stir Fry starts by marinating raw ground beef in a mixture of soy sauce, garlic, sesame oil, brown sugar, rice vinegar, ginger, chili garlic sauce, and cornstarch. This imparts deep flavor and tenderizes the meat. The green beans are cooked separately in canola oil, blistered for a slight char and softened while maintaining bite, then combined with ginger, garlic, and red pepper flakes to build aroma and gentle heat.

After cooking the beef until browned, the beans return to the pan, mixing with the meat and allowing excess moisture to evaporate. The result is a dish with a balance of tender, flavorful meat and crisp-tender green beans, carrying a hint of sweetness and spice from the marinade and aromatics.

Ingredients

Servings
  • 1 pound ground beef
  • 8 oz green beans trimmed and cut in half
  • 1/4 tsp red pepper flakes more or less to taste
  • 2 tsp ginger grated, fresh
  • 2 cloves garlic minced
  • 1 tbsp canola oil or other neutral oil with high smoke point

For the Marinade

  • 1/4 cup soy sauce low sodium
  • 4 cloves garlic finely minced or grated
  • 1 tablespoon sesame oil
  • 2 tablespoons brown sugar
  • 1 tablespoon rice vinegar
  • 1 tablespoon ginger root grated
  • 1 teaspoon Chili garlic sauce
  • 1 tbsp cornstarch

Instructions

  1. Whisk together all ingredients for the marinade. Place raw ground beef in a medium sized bowl, pour marinade over beef, stir to fully combine. Set aside for 20 minutes.
  2. Heat a sauté pan over medium high heat. Add one tablespoon of oil. Cook the green beans, stirring often, until starting to blister, 3-4 minutes. Add in ginger, garlic, red pepper flakes, cook 30-60 seconds until fragrant. Remove from pan and reserve on a plate.
  3. Add beef, cook until browned.
  4. Add green beans back to the pan, stir to combine.
  5. Continue cooking until excess moisture has evaporated.
